72 to 74 rollout 14 extremes on an 8 inch rim is a great starting point for a 4-10 mil cub.
There are too many variables on any given day at any given track to get the perfect tire.
You either get a tire that works well at most places, or you have a few sets of tires that work the best at any one given location....and of course with temperature, moisture and gearing...it changes...

Each bike is different. I have ran 73 Ro 14 extremes on my 4mm cub. Worked pretty good but i weigh 165ibs so I spun them like crazy. So now I have a set of 78 ro 14 staggered extremes on a 10" rim they seem to be working better for my weight. I'd go with the 73 Ro 14 extremes best all around tire IMO, Also works great with many motor combo's. Shayne is right it all depends on your bike setup as well. You gearing type of chassis mods and overall weight
